Output 58a259cc884386476ca4c3f51d96eb1aba3bdcfa3bba975f63ef42f5a9841d85:5

value
45285781630
script pubkey
OP_0 OP_PUSHBYTES_20 05c1e6b1bed0a8db6ff7a560c69b498eaa766faf
address
tb1qqhq7dvd76z5dkmlh54svdx6f3648vma02yqk6e
transaction
58a259cc884386476ca4c3f51d96eb1aba3bdcfa3bba975f63ef42f5a9841d85
confirmations
132123
spent
true